Legal background
- The UK’s legislative framework in relation to education, children’s social care and child employment is governed by many different pieces of legislation, a number of which are amended by this Act. The Act mainly makes textual amendments to other Acts. The following is a list of the main legislation which is amended or referenced by the Act. The commentary on provisions in the Act sets out how previous legislation is referenced and amended.
